Nickel Alloy MIG Wire provides a specialist welding solution for joining and cladding nickel-based alloys used in high-temperature, corrosive and demanding service environments. Designed for excellent arc stability, controlled weld metal chemistry and superior resistance to cracking, these wires produce high-integrity welds with outstanding mechanical and corrosion-resistant properties.
The range includes Alloy 82, Alloy 625 and FNi 55 grades for welding nickel alloys, cast irons and dissimilar material combinations. Commonly used in power generation, chemical processing, oil and gas, marine and repair applications, these wires deliver reliable performance and long-term durability in challenging industrial environments.
